Project Description

We designed & built Ishtar restaurant in 2004. The project took 7 months to complete from design to build. Ishtar restaurant is in the heart of London serving delicious Turkish and continental food. You can visit Ishtar restaurant at 10-12 Crawford Street London W1U 6AZ. www.ishtar-restaurant.com Tel: 020 7224 2446